Have a repository that reached the 2GB size limit. This repository sits on Bitbucket cloud.

I've seen the instructions on rewinding commits to get under the 2GB time limit but I don't know how to execute the commands against the cloud repository.

Git novice here, so my knowledge is limited.

Is there a way to run command line against the cloud repository so that I can rewind commits?

The commands to undo the last commit has to be executed on your local clone of the repository, and once you have undone the commit locally you push it back to Bitbucket and that should reduce the repository there.
